INTRODUCTION
The
Heathkit
Model
SB-401
SSB
Transmitter
is
capable
of
SSB
(upper
or
lower
Sideband)
and
CW
operation
on
all
amateur
bands
from
3,5
to
30
megahertz,
A
crystal-controlled
heterodyne
oscillator
and
a
preassembled,
prealigned
linear
master
oscillator
insure
highly
accurate
and
stable
operation,
Complete
Transceive
capabilities
are
available
when
the
Transmitter
is
used
with
the
Heathkit
Model
SB-300,
SB-301,
ot
SB-303
Receiver.
The
Transmitter
can
also
be
used
with
other
receivers
by
installing
the
SBA-401-1
Crystal
Accessory
Kit
in
the
Transmitter.
This
Transmitter
is
compatible
with
the
Heathkit
Model
SB-200
SSB
Linear
Amplifier.
Other
operating
features
include:
voice
oper-
|
ated
(VOX)
and
push-to-talk
(PTT)
control
in
the
SSB
mode;
break-in
keying
in
the
CW
mode;
built-in
antenna
change-over
relay;
switched
120
VAC
to
operate
an
external
an-
tenna
relay;
crystal
filter
type
SSB
generator;
HEATHEIT®
and
automatic
level
control
to
prevent
distor-
tion
while
providing
high
talk
power,
The
large
circular
dial
has
calibration
marks
every
kilo-
hertz
and
covers
100
kilohertz
for
every
revo-
lution
to
provide
a
bandspread
equal
to
approxi-
mately
10
feet
per
megahertz,
A
slide-rule-
type
dial
pointer
clearly
indicates
the
number
of
rotations
of
the
circular
dial,
The
knob-to-dial
ratio
is
approximately
4:1,
All-aluminum
metal
parts
provide
light-weight
and
sturdy
construction,
Assembly
time-saving
features
include
circuit
boards,
wiring
cable
assemblies,
and
a
preassembled
LMO
tuning
unit,
The
transformer-operated,
silicon
diode
power
supply
is
a
long-life,
low-heat
power
source,
